This special exhibit features 18 Story Cloths from the La Crosse County Historical Society's artifact collection and loaned from the Hmong Cultural and Community Center. This exhibit commemorates the 50th anniversary of Hmong resettlement in the United States and illustrates the history of the Hmong and Hmong Americans through various...

Mississippi Melodies is a weekly summer concert series held on the lawn outside the Black River Beach Neighborhood Center. Join us every Tuesday from 12:00pm–1:00pm, starting June 3rd through September 2nd, for live music under the sun! Each week features a different local musician or band! We suggest bringing a...
